Elderly bathtub installation services focus on adapting bathroom fixtures to meet the specific needs of senior residents. These services typically involve replacing standard bathtubs with accessible options that prioritize safety and ease of use. Features may include low-threshold designs, non-slip surfaces, grab bars, and ergonomic controls. The goal is to create a bathing environment that minimizes the risk of slips and falls while providing comfort and independence for seniors.
This service helps address common issues associated with traditional bathtubs that can pose hazards for elderly individuals. Difficult-to-enter tubs, high sides, and slippery surfaces can increase the likelihood of accidents. Installing walk-in or walk-through bathtubs can significantly reduce these risks, making bathing safer and more manageable. Additionally, modifications such as built-in seating or handheld showerheads can enhance comfort and convenience for users with limited mobility or joint issues.

Installation Costs - The cost for elderly bathtub installation typ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on the tub type and complexity of the setup. Basic installations may be closer to the lower end, while custom features increase the price. Local pros can provide specific estimates based on individual needs.
Material Expenses - The price of bathtub materials varies, with standard options costing around $300 to $1,200. High-end or specialized tubs, such as walk-in models or those with safety features, can cost significantly more. Material choice influences overall project costs.
Labor Charges - Labor for elderly bathtub installation generally ranges from $500 to $2,000, depending on the scope of work and local rates. More complex installations or additional modifications can increase labor costs. Pros often provide detailed quotes after assessing the site.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include plumbing adjustments, electrical work, or removal of old fixtures, which can add $200 to $800. These fees vary based on the existing setup and required modifications. Contact local service providers for precise estimates tailored to specific situations.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
